Output 73d198c29e24492814be5a14d911e0cd2c7e0583c5c18b7e72374ae9145e031a:1

value
823740116
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f81f566d6c6c07b2ca296b515577078a7ee8209 OP_EQUAL
address
3371k6vytafVPAih3kJRaNyiLF6JHggeZ6
transaction
73d198c29e24492814be5a14d911e0cd2c7e0583c5c18b7e72374ae9145e031a
spent
true